How they compare
Costa Rica currently reports 35.53 against 29.76 in Uganda, a difference of 5.77.
That makes Costa Rica's figure about 1.2 times Uganda's.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 14 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Uganda ahead.
Costa Rica ranks 67th and Uganda ranks 68th of 229 countries.
Uganda has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
